Sensor Size

The sensor is the heart of a digital camera, capturing light to form an image. Larger sensors, like full-frame or APS-C, generally perform better in low light, offer a wider dynamic range, and provide shallower depth of field for artistic background blur. Smaller sensors, found in compact cameras or smartphones, are more affordable and make for smaller devices but may compromise image quality in challenging conditions.

Lens Versatility

For interchangeable lens cameras (DSLRs and mirrorless), the lens system is crucial. Consider the types of photography you plan to pursue. Wide-angle lenses are ideal for landscapes and architecture, telephoto lenses excel at capturing distant subjects like wildlife or sports, and prime lenses often offer superior image quality and wider apertures for low-light shooting and bokeh. Some systems offer a vast array of native lenses, while others may require adapters for third-party options.

Build Quality and Ergonomics

A camera should feel comfortable and intuitive to operate. Look for durable construction, especially if you plan to shoot in demanding environments. Consider the placement of buttons and dials – do they fall naturally under your fingers? Weather sealing can be a significant advantage for outdoor photographers. For mirrorless and DSLR cameras, the viewfinder type (optical vs. electronic) and screen articulation (tilt, swivel, or fixed) also contribute to the overall user experience.

What is the difference between a DSLR and a mirrorless camera?
DSLR cameras use a mirror mechanism to reflect light from the lens to an optical viewfinder. Mirrorless cameras, as the name suggests, lack this mirror, sending light directly to the sensor and displaying the image on an electronic viewfinder or the rear screen. Mirrorless cameras are generally smaller and lighter, while DSLRs often have longer battery life and a wider selection of lenses.
How important is megapixels for image quality?
While megapixels determine the resolution and potential print size of an image, they are not the sole factor in image quality. Sensor size, lens quality, and image processing software play equally important roles. For most everyday use and web sharing, even cameras with moderate megapixel counts produce excellent results.
What does 'aperture' mean, and why is it important?
Aperture refers to the opening within a lens that controls the amount of light entering the camera. It's measured in f-stops (e.g., f/1.8, f/4). A wider aperture (smaller f-number) allows more light for low-light shooting and creates a shallow depth of field, blurring the background. A narrower aperture (larger f-number) increases the depth of field, keeping more of the scene in focus.
Should I choose a camera with a fixed lens or interchangeable lenses?
A fixed-lens camera, like a compact or bridge camera, offers simplicity and portability as the lens is built-in. Interchangeable lens cameras (DSLRs and mirrorless) provide greater creative flexibility, allowing you to swap lenses for different photographic situations. This choice depends on your photographic goals and willingness to invest in a lens system.
